A pandiagonal magic square or panmagic square (also diabolic square, diabolical square or diabolical magic square) is a magic square with the additional property that the broken diagonals, i. the diagonals that wrap round at the edges of the square, also add up to the magic constant. For an 8 by 8 the minisquares are 2 by 2, for a 12 by 12 the minisquares are 3 by 3 and so on. A magic square will remain magic if any number multiplies every number of a magic square. A magic square will remain magic if two rows, or columns, equidistant from the centre are interchanged. An even order magic square ( n x n where n is even) will remain magic if the quadrants are interchanged. Okay, so we will first look a t solving a 3 by 3 magic square puzzle. All of the Order 4 PanMagic Squares are based on extracting small Magic Carpets from a large underlying binary pattern (on the Right). Four samples of this pattern shown on the left may be multiplied by 8, 4, 2, and 1, to make the Carpets which are added together to make the final square. Can a 4 by 4 magic square be completed with the numbers 1 through 16 for entries? I first need to determine my target sum. The sum of all the values 1 through 16 is 136. Dividing this result gives 34, which is my target sum for each row, column, and diagonal. simply adding q to each square in Figure 1, you obtain a magic square of total T. Naturally, the numbers are still consecutive (from 1 q to 16 q ) and every group of 4 squares that add to 34 in Figure 1 now adds to T in the new square. Formula to fill any magic square.
